Diesel Loco Shed, Guntakal is an engine shed located in Guntakal, Andhra Pradesh in India.[1] It falls under the jurisdiction of Guntakal railway division of South Central Railway zone.
It is one of the oldest loco sheds, started in 1964 as a M.G Shed.[2]

Locomotives
| SN | Locomotives | HP | Quantity | Image |
|---|---|---|---|---|
| 1. | WDG-3A | 3100 | 30 | File:GTL WDG3A.jpg |
| 2. | WDM-3A | 22 | File:GTL WDM3A twins.jpg | |
| 3. | WDM-3D | 3300 | 33 | File:GTL WDM3D TWINS.jpg |
| 4. | WDS-6 | 1400 | 3 | File:SSB WDS6.jpg |
| 5. | WAG-7 | 5350 | 79 | File:NKJ WAG7.jpg |
| Total Locomotives Active as of May 2022[3][4][5] | 167 | |||
